This video goes over the Proclamation of 1763. The Proclamation of 1763, issued by King George III, prevented settlement past a line that passed through the Appalachian Mountain Range.

George Washington's farewell address was an important statement in which the nation's first president warned America against getting involved in foreign conflicts and affairs. This video goes into depth about his stance on foreign affairs and the context of this farewell address.
